OCR Tips
Use 300 DPI When You Can
Clean 300 DPI scans usually balance recognition quality and processing time better than low-resolution images.
Choose All Main Languages
For bilingual documents, select both languages so names and short phrases are less likely to be misread.
Review Critical Output
OCR can confuse similar characters such as O and 0, l and 1, or rn and m. Verify important numbers before filing.
